#9b3ae2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b3ae2 is composed of 60.8% red, 22.7%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 74.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 274.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 55.7%. #9b3ae2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ff74ff with #3700c5.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9b3ae2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050108 is the darkest color, while #faf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b3ae2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8894 is the less saturated color, while #9f20fc is the most saturated one.
